Beware Online Travel Scams
Some common types of online travel scams include:
Fake travel websites: Scammers may create fake travel websites that look legitimate but are designed to steal personal and financial information from visitors. These websites may offer deals that seem too good to be true or require users to enter personal information or credit card numbers to book travel.
Vacation rental scams: In this type of scam, the scammer poses as a vacation rental owner or property manager and advertises a property that is not available for rent or does not exist. The scammer may ask for payment in advance or require the victim to wire money to hold the rental.
Ticket scams: Scammers may create fake ticket websites or listings for popular events, like concerts or sports games, and sell tickets that do not exist. They may ask for payment in advance or require the victim to wire money to secure the tickets.
To avoid falling victim to online travel scams, it's important to be skeptical of any deals or offers that seem too good to be true. Always research the travel website or rental property before making a reservation or payment. You can do this by conducting an online search for reviews or complaints about the company or property, checking with the Better Business Bureau, or contacting the property owner directly to verify the rental availability. Additionally, never wire money or send cash to anyone you don't know and trust, and use a credit card for travel purchases whenever possible, as credit cards offer more protection against fraud.
